Elizabeth Ann Cockhill (Tousaw), beloved wife of Melvyn Cockhill, cherished mother of Bonnie (Charlie Chen), John (Caroline), and James (Andrea Baldwin), and dear grandmother of Shelby, Evan, Nathan, Fuji, Bradley, Hannah, Mingji, and Melissa, and sister of Ross, Joan and Barbara. Passed away peacefully at the Royal Victoria Hospital on Thursday, January 9th. Ann spent her life volunteering at church and Meals on Wheels. Over the years she was very active in sports: skiing (downhill and cross-country), badminton, and bowling, and also a very active curler at Lachine Curling Club for 40 years. A memorial service will be held at Summerlea United Church at a later date.
In lieu of flowers, donations may be made in memory of Ann to Scleroderma Canada.
